Objective
By the end of this lesson, you will learn about the Civil War, its causes, key figures, and major events.
Materials and Prep
Materials needed: paper, pencils, coloring supplies, computer for research
Prep: None
Activities
1. Civil War Timeline: Create a timeline of key events in the Civil War. Draw pictures and write short descriptions for each event.
2. Research Project: Choose a famous figure from the Civil War (e.g., Abraham Lincoln, Robert E. Lee) and research their life and contributions.
3. Battle Map: Draw a map showing the major battle sites of the Civil War. Color each side with different colors.
Talking Points
- Causes of the Civil War: "The Civil War started because some states wanted to leave the United States. This was because they disagreed about important things like slavery and states' rights."
- Key Figures: "Abraham Lincoln was the President of the United States during the Civil War. He wanted to keep the country together. Robert E. Lee was a famous Confederate general who led the Southern army."
- Major Events: "The Battle of Gettysburg was a big battle that happened in Pennsylvania. It was a turning point in the war. The Emancipation Proclamation was a law that President Lincoln made to free the slaves in Confederate states."
